Question
Hi, I am trying to find the tranny dipstick to check the fluid, but cannot seem to locate it. I think Reverse is going out, but hubby says I just need to check the fluid. (My thinking is that if it was low on fluid, it would be having trouble shifting in all gears, not just reverse). Thanks for your help! Stef

Answer
Stefanee,
The dip stick should be at the back of the engine next to the fire wall. It is difficult to see, but will have a pull ring with latch.
Low fluid will cause unusual shifting. If the clutch disk are burned this can cause slippage. If the fluid is not bright but cloudy and dark and has a burned odor, this is also an indication of slippage or component failure.
Some people have the mistaken opinion that replacing very dark fluid with new fluid will improve performance, however, new fluid has detergents that will sash of some of the particles that help with friction. Once these particles are gone the transmission gets worse rather than better.

Mercedes has specific procedures for changing fluid and you should use only Mercedes factor fluid or equivalent.
